We Read the Book- So What? Meaningful Activities That Help Students Answer this Question

July 14, 2019 Elizabeth Taylor
Copy of Untitled.png

Regardless of our years of experience in the classroom, we have all likely experienced the student who finishes that book you assigned and proceeds to slam it down on the desk in a flourish of drama, shouting loudly to the rest of the class that they have finally finished. This is generally associated with as much distraction inducing noise as humanly possible, with an eye roll so severe that you fear their eyeballs may pop right from their heads.
